Output 89937ec0884201251adf15498a65daea3be68a9b673d7a7919c6e9af91ff0f58:0

value
11507500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2f8ffa49b8c3af0c59e9683c6acd9757236736e OP_EQUALVERIFY OP_CHECKSIG
address
LeTUTDw9rkaim8uNU8amfNi2ANUEkrxEdU
transaction
89937ec0884201251adf15498a65daea3be68a9b673d7a7919c6e9af91ff0f58
spent
true